#513d61 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#513d61 is composed of 31.8% red, 23.9%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.5% cyan, 37.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 62% black. It has a hue angle of 273.3 degrees, a saturation of 22.8% and a lightness of 31%. #513d61 color hex could be obtained by blending #a27ac2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#513d61 color description : Very dark desaturated violet.
#513d61 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#513d61 has RGB values of R:81, G:61, B:97 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0.37, Y:0,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 5324129.

Shades and Tints of #513d61
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f6f4f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#513d61
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#504955 is the less saturated color, while #58009e is the most saturated one.
